Position Summary
The UNM School ofMedicine, Department of Psychiatry & Behavioral Sciences is seeking aProgram Coordinator. If you are a detailed and organized professional wholearns new software easily and enjoys interacting with different people, thismedical education coordinator position offers excellent opportunities. Ourprogram coordinator will manage day-to-day administrative, operational, andfiscal activities of Psychiatry and Behavioral Health Residency, Fellowship,and Internship programs. This is a busy and dynamic position working in acollaborative and friendly team. The medical education program coordinator willserve as an important liaison and facilitator, problem-solver and communicator. Thesuccessful candidate will have proven success in a team environment and possessthe following qualities: data management andcomputer/software aptitude; ability to manage multiple tasks simultaneously;be responsive and very detail-oriented; value exceptional customer service; and strictly maintainconfidentiality.
Duties include:- Coordinating annual acceptance of applicants into advanced medical training programs-processing applications, scheduling interviews, handling candidate evaluations, and reporting
- Coordinating complex clinical rotation schedules
- Collecting and analyzing required data, maintaining records and evaluations and tracking progress using program-specific software
- Providing administrative support including preparing agendas, meeting minutes maintaining calendars, correspondence, booking facilities, answering phones
- Monitoring and administering budgets and payments, reconciling expenses, assisting with travel, purchasing. Will hold a UNM a purchasing card
- Coordinating multiple meetings virtual and on-site; planning and organizing orientations, retreats, ceremonies, graduations, and other events
